Yes Kitten, this Friday's Crush of the Week is Joe Flaningan or in this case Lt. Colonel John Sheppard from Stargate Atlantis.

Joe has had more than twenty guest starring roles on television since 1994 in everything from Dawson's Creek, to Profiler to Tru Calling before landing his role on Stargate SG1 and Stargate Atlantis. He began his career as a writer and is credited with two episodes of Stargate Atlantis, Epiphany in 2005 and Outcast in 2008.
